The first social media platform, SixDegrees.com, was launched in 2000. However, it was Friendster, launched in 2002, that gained widespread popularity. MySpace, founded in 2003, was another early player in the social media space. These platforms allowed users to create profiles, connect with friends, and share content, but the concept of social media content was still in its infancy. Today, social media content is more diverse and complex than ever. The rise of short-form video platforms like TikTok (2016) and Reels (2020) has transformed the way people create and consume content. Social media platforms have also become essential channels for customer service, with many businesses using them to interact with customers and resolve issues.
